git: 8353e4f0dd2a - main - finance/kraft: Update to 1.2.2
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Mon, 17 Feb 2025 10:12:27 UTC
The branch main has been updated by jhale: URL: https://cgit.FreeBSD.org/ports/commit/?id=8353e4f0dd2a642f546ec7c10089b734330b2f19 commit 8353e4f0dd2a642f546ec7c10089b734330b2f19 Author: Jason E. Hale <jhale@FreeBSD.org> AuthorDate: 2025-02-17 09:51:56 +0000 Commit: Jason E. Hale <jhale@FreeBSD.org> CommitDate: 2025-02-17 10:12:20 +0000 finance/kraft: Update to 1.2.2 Fix port sanity: Remove now KF6-only Pim components. Port now builds, just without KDE Pim support. Add required Qt components that were previously pulled in tranitively. --- finance/kraft/Makefile | 17 +++++++---------- finance/kraft/distinfo | 6 +++--- finance/kraft/pkg-plist | 1 - 3 files changed, 10 insertions(+), 14 deletions(-) diff --git a/finance/kraft/Makefile b/finance/kraft/Makefile index f3270fad14a3..ee751cb5a33a 100644 --- a/finance/kraft/Makefile +++ b/finance/kraft/Makefile @@ -1,6 +1,6 @@ PORTNAME= kraft DISTVERSIONPREFIX= v -DISTVERSION= 1.2.1 +DISTVERSION= 1.2.2 CATEGORIES= finance kde MAINTAINER= kde@FreeBSD.org @@ -15,19 +15,16 @@ BUILD_DEPENDS= bash:shells/bash \ rubygem-asciidoctor>=1.5.7<3:textproc/rubygem-asciidoctor LIB_DEPENDS= libctemplate.so:textproc/google-ctemplate -USES= cmake compiler:c++11-lang gettext grantlee:5 kde:5 qt:5 \ - shebangfix +# iconv is just used for run +USES= cmake compiler:c++11-lang gettext-tools grantlee:5 iconv \ + kde:5 qt:5 shebangfix USE_GITHUB= yes GH_ACCOUNT= dragotin -USE_KDE= akonadi akonadicontacts \ - auth codecs config configwidgets contacts coreaddons \ - grantleetheme i18n itemmodels widgetsaddons \ +USE_KDE= config contacts i18n \ ecm:build -USE_QT= core dbus gui sql widgets xml \ - buildtools:build qmake:build +USE_QT= core gui sql svg widgets xml xmlpatterns \ + buildtools:build qmake:build testlib:build SHEBANG_FILES= manual/makeman.sh -CFLAGS+= -I${LOCALBASE}/include/KPim5 - .include <bsd.port.mk> diff --git a/finance/kraft/distinfo b/finance/kraft/distinfo index 31c344b9ef3c..4727700bec87 100644 --- a/finance/kraft/distinfo +++ b/finance/kraft/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1719019238 -SHA256 (dragotin-kraft-v1.2.1_GH0.tar.gz) = 26f8e3ff7d12c86846b6db49ce171af31115f66119f9a7cce13de15f1397dd64 -SIZE (dragotin-kraft-v1.2.1_GH0.tar.gz) = 6001325 +TIMESTAMP = 1739777108 +SHA256 (dragotin-kraft-v1.2.2_GH0.tar.gz) = a1b556d89fb42853e0c085dd47d19546f9dfd70a0f58e161cc56fa4d5555190e +SIZE (dragotin-kraft-v1.2.2_GH0.tar.gz) = 6001871 diff --git a/finance/kraft/pkg-plist b/finance/kraft/pkg-plist index ce6757005e9a..f47969a02c66 100644 --- a/finance/kraft/pkg-plist +++ b/finance/kraft/pkg-plist @@ -1,4 +1,3 @@ -bin/findcontact bin/kraft share/applications/de.volle_kraft_voraus.kraft.desktop share/config.kcfg/databasesettings.kcfg